How DIY Fundraisers Ignite Change DIY fundraisers put power back into community hands. They’re flexible, creative, and deeply personal, just like the families we support. Backyard Concerts & Open-Mic NightsInvite local talent, sell tickets, and share stories between acts. Music unites, and when every note contributes to a cause, the impact resonates long after the final encore. Sponsored Fitness ChallengesHost a “Fun Run for Families” or a “Spin-Cycle Marathon.” Participants secure pledges per lap, per song, or per kilometre - raising funds while boosting wellbeing. Art-for-Impact ExhibitionsShowcase youth artwork alongside pieces by established local artists. Auction proceeds can fund creative workshops or mentoring programs. Digital Campaigns & Matching GiftsLaunch a month-long online drive with daily spotlights on individual stories - then partner with a local business to match every donation up to a set amount.
